Output 682bb2cdb2b23d41481a4e285ec07b5e92e02c31f1df16d699abccbcdadd200e:0

value
17912123
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6b6ed53615c39f4e0a3286a9a3f7fa5c8c8bfd21 OP_EQUAL
address
3BV4zsVve1DmVo8ddSAhFQdMbKYoKzWFqu
transaction
682bb2cdb2b23d41481a4e285ec07b5e92e02c31f1df16d699abccbcdadd200e
confirmations
548436
spent
true